Admission Criteria

Review of Online Application: Your application will be reviewed only after the online application is completed and the non-refundable application fee of EUR 120 has been paid.

⚠️ Please note: A rejection may occur at any stage of the application process. We strongly recommend applicants carefully review the following criteria before applying.

  1. Availability of Places: Class sizes are limited. Please contact the school or visit the OpenApply platform to find out which vacancies are still available.
  1. Age Requirements:
  • Minimum age: 10 years old by September 1st for entry into Year 1 (Grade 5).
  • Entry into the IB Diploma Programme (Years 7 & 8) is possible only until the age of 17.
  1. Reason for Application: Priority is given to international families relocating to Linz due to employment. Applicants must live in Linz or surrounding areas with their parents or legal guardians.
  1. Academic Performance & Language Skills*: We assess previous academic achievement and language proficiency through school records and placement tests. See “Required Documents” and “Placement Test Information” for details.
  1. Personal Profile: We value students with strong motivation, positive conduct, and a proactive approach to learning. Recommendation letters from previous schools are highly appreciated.
  1. Visa Requirements: Applicants must already have a valid visa before enrolling. The school will not accept students who intend to obtain Austrian residency after being admitted.
  1. Positive Placement Tests – Academic Assessment: All applicants must complete placement tests. These tests help evaluate academic suitability, language support needs, and potential for success in our academic programme.
  • Duration: 2–3 hours
  • Assessment Areas: Academic readiness, language proficiency, tutoring needs
  • IB Compatibility: Evaluated by the IB Coordinator where applicable
  1. Positive Interview: Successful applicants will be invited to a personal interview (20–60 minutes) based on the information in the online application.
  • Attendance: The student and at least one parent must attend
  • Purpose: To get to know the applicant and family
  • Residency: Only students living with their parents/family in Linz or the surrounding areas are eligible

Formal Decision on Admission: Our headmaster, coordinators, and admission department are involved in the processing and managing your application to the Linz International School Auhof. If your application is not accepted at any stage in the admissions process, we shall notify you by email.

Required Documents:

Please upload the following documents as part of your online application:

  1. Report Cards
    • Current academic year
    • Previous two academic years
    • Translations required if not in English or German
  2. Attendance and Behaviour Report
    • OR a reference letter from the current/previous school
  3. English Language Certificate (Grade 11 / IB Entry, if English is not the first academic language)
    • Cambridge FCE for Schools (Level B2 – CEFR)
    • Oxford English for Schools (Level B2 – CEFR)
    • IELTS Academic: Overall Band Score 7.0
  4. Passport Copies
    • Of the student and parents/legal guardians
    • Plus a passport-size photo of the student
  5. Residential Registration Form (Meldezettel)
    • Of the entire family
  6. Statement of Employer
    • For international families relocating to Austria due to employment
